Rappers typically rock a mean kick game and Chance is no different. Chance has been on since about 2013 but his career really started taking off when he made XXL’s 2014 Freshman Class list. Since then he’s been making that Hip-Hop money and copping hot releases. Lets take a quick stroll through some of Chance’s best kicks. Actually, Chance usually kills the entire outfit so keep that in mind when checking out how he pairs his kicks. Sometimes people forget there’s more to a look than the shoes lol.
Typical stunt with the ‘Red October”s in hand. The Yeezy II needs no introduction at this point.
Chance in the cut with 2 Chainz and Lil’ Wayne wearing the NikeLAB Air Max 1 ‘Royal’.
At this year’s iHeart Radio awards Chance showed he could hit the ‘dad fit’ with the best of ’em. Did the Adidas Yeezy 500 ‘Blush’.
When Supreme teams up with Nike they always shut it down. The red Supreme Air More Uptempo looks fantastic when paired with denim.
While performing at the iHeart Radio Awards Chance switched up his kicks to the Air Max 97 Retro ‘Metallic Gold’.
You know you’ve made it when hosting Saturday Night Live and Chance stunted in the Adidas Yeezy Wave Runners.
It’s not all about exclusive kicks, here ‘Lil Chano’ destroys this retro fit with the Air Jordan 1 Mid ‘Olympic Red’.
Okay, okay, okay… maybe it is all about hyped-up, exclusive, kicks. Are these Off White x Air Max 97’s the best of ‘The 10’?
There’s a theme here, Chance switches up from Jordan and Adidas Yeezy often. Here he is unboxing a new pair of Adidas Yeezy 750 ‘Chocolate’s.
Lastly a court-side classic, the Air Jordan III ‘True Blue.’
